Summary:
"Drawing on a range of contributors, case studies and examples, this book examines ways in which we can think about design through Deleuze, and likewise how Deleuze's thought can be experimented upon and re-designed to produce new concepts. Discussions include materiality, creativity, objects, the future, innovation, the designed environment and the interaction between human non-human agents." -- Back cover.
